We’re seeing severe weather in Louisiana on this election day.  A Lafayette TV station is reporting a tornado touched down in Basile, which is located in Acadia and Evangeline Parishes. KLFY-TV is reporting at least two people were injured.

And we are watching Tropical Storm Rafael which is expected to enter the Gulf of Mexico as a hurricane on Thursday, but lose it’s intensity as it moves towards the Louisiana coast.

According to the Secretary of State’s Office, just under 975-thousand people have already early voted or turned in an absentee ballot. The Presidential race tops the ballot, but there are also Congressional races, a PSC race and one constitutional amendment about funding for the coast.
